Honestly, my only real issue with progression now is that it is boring. If you only play one or two classes, it's pretty easy to get enough crafting parts to buy and upgrade the cards you want to use, at least until you get to the top tier, and i'm not far enough along for those ones yet. There is no sense of reward for getting any of these cards and perks. At least with the old Hutt contract system you had to play different weapons and things to earn new stuff, so it forced you to play outside your comfort zone to earn new equipment and weapons. The only thing that takes any real effort for the reward is earning new weapons and mods by playing as that class and getting kills.

That said, the core game is still fun. I need to start playing the star fighter mode but i really suck at anything in a ship so i've been avoiding it.
